I have the same bench grinder. Cherry red paint and pleasing shape. But what a kooky half-baked design.
Great well balanced motor, nice cast iron base, crappy pressure-cast garbage alloy, hard to braze, shatter happy proprietary design toolrests, and finally the cherry on this sunday......a fragile switch assembly.

All easily fixed with a real switch and thicker mounting plate, steel angle iron made into beefy tool rests, and probably do something about the 1930's style boxy explodey-doodle (possibly PCB) capacitor under the kimono.
